Tree removal services involve the careful and efficient process of cutting down and removing trees that are no longer suitable for a property. This work often includes assessing the tree’s health, size, and location to determine the safest way to bring it down without causing damage to nearby structures, landscaping, or power lines. Once the tree is felled, the service typically extends to stump grinding and debris cleanup, leaving the property clear and safe. These services are performed by experienced contractors who use specialized equipment to handle trees of various sizes and types, ensuring the job is completed safely and effectively.
Many property owners seek tree removal services to address specific problems that can threaten safety or property value. Overgrown or diseased trees can pose a risk of falling during storms or high winds, potentially causing damage or injury. Trees with dead or dying branches may also become hazards, especially if they are located near homes, driveways, or utility lines. Additionally, trees that have outgrown their space can interfere with power lines, block sunlight, or impede visibility, prompting the need for removal to maintain a safe and functional outdoor environment.

The overview below groups typical Tree Removal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in El Dorado County,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Tree Removals -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for small tree removal jobs, such as removing a single, healthy tree under 20 feet tall. Many routine projects fall within this range, though costs can vary based on tree location and accessibility.
Medium-Sized Tree Removal - For trees ranging from 20 to 40 feet, costs generally range from $600 to $1,500. Larger or more complex projects in this category are less common but can reach up to $2,500 depending on factors like tree density and site conditions.
Larger or Hazardous Tree Removal - Removing bigger trees over 40 feet can cost between $1,500 and $3,500, with some complex cases exceeding $5,000. These projects are less frequent and often involve additional equipment or safety precautions.
Full Tree Removal and Stump Grinding - Complete removal, including stump grinding, usually ranges from $300 to $1,000 for smaller trees, while larger projects can cost $2,000 or more. Costs depend on tree size, location, and whether stump removal is included.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
